Tinka has advice for adjusting skincare for the colder seasons with the power of natural products that get results Santa Barbara, CA – (Aug 11th, 2021): When the season changes, we change our wardrobe, our schedules, but what about our skincare routine? The air becomes drier outside and inside during cooler months, directly affecting the skin and increasing sensitivity, dryness, and irritation. Hyaluronic Acid to retain moisture: This winter beauty must-have plumps, softens, and hydrates the skin, helping the skin to retain moisture throughout the day. Hyaluronic Acid also reduces the visibility of fine lines and wrinkles. Chamomile to fight inflammation: Not only is chamomile full of antioxidants, but it is also anti-inflammatory and dramatically benefits all types of skin - especially dry or inflamed skin.
